What You will do
The Project Manager, Storage Management will apply demonstrated project management skills to:
- Develop and maintain project documentation including project plans, timelines, work packages, risk registers, status reports, and minutes in accordance with agreed templates and document management systems.
- Assign tasks and responsibilities, motivate project team members, monitor and report on progress and escalate issues to the Project Board in accordance with agreed tolerances.
- Manage the project budget, procure and allocate resources, monitor expenditure and report variances.
- Establish quality standards and ensure they are met throughout the project. Coordinate quality assurance reviews and make recommendations for corrective actions to address quality issues.
- Under direction of the Project Board, identify potential risks; develop mitigation strategies and contingency plans; monitor and manage risks throughout the project lifecycle.
- Act as the main point of contact for project stakeholders. Communicate project status, and issues to stakeholders regularly.
- Provide advice to Heads, Biodiversity and Geosciences, and Program, Cultures and Histories - Collections Research and Exhibitions, for the implementation of agreed projects. This includes preparing policies, procedures, submissions, briefing notes, proposals, and other correspondence.
- Work collaboratively with the Director Infrastructure and Strategic Asset Management to maintain business continuity and implement best practices by providing timely updates and insights on Infrastructure projects and contributing to the overall effectiveness and efficiency of site management.
- Champion organisational purpose, values and strategic priorities and provide timely, accurate and high-quality advice to the Director Infrastructure and Strategic Asset Management as required.
- Maintain a strong control environment within the team through compliance with QM values, policies, procedures and legislation.
- Contribute to the safety culture of QM by reporting all incidents and hazards and ensuring work is undertaken in the safest way possible, following all QM WHS policies and/or procedures and guidelines relevant to the job.
